My ancient T'bolt (purchased well-used several months ago) also went from
1023 to
1024.  A quick look at IQ phase data I was recording (referred to a
free-running PRS-10)
shows no discernible glitch at the moment of rollover.

This old T'bolt has been living in 1999 for as long as I've had it.  So
tonight it went from
Aug 21, 1999 to Aug 22, 1999.  I'll be interested in seeing what that date
does over the
next several months.

I also have a CNS Clock II, which went smoothly to week 2048, and it  shows
the
correct UTC date.  I confess that I forgot to see what week # it showed
before the
big event, but suspect it was 2047 (not 1023).  Shame on me!
